Summary

This throat spray contains beneficial ingredients like Mānuka honey, which is known for its antimicrobial properties, and peppermint oil, which helps freshen breath. However, the presence of alcohol, which can cause dry mouth by reducing saliva production, is a concern. The product has a mix of natural and potentially irritating ingredients, leading to a moderate score.

MGO 400+ Mānuka Honey
Good

Mānuka honey is known for its antimicrobial properties, which can help reduce harmful bacteria in the mouth. It contains methylglyoxal (MGO), which contributes to its antibacterial activity. It is a natural ingredient that can support oral health.

Risks

People with honey allergies should avoid it, and it may contribute to tooth decay if not used properly.

Benefits

Mānuka honey can help reduce oral bacteria and promote overall oral health.

Alcohol
Bad

Alcohol is often used as a solvent and preservative in oral care products. However, it can cause dry mouth by reducing saliva production, which is essential for oral health. It is generally not recommended for those with dry mouth conditions.

Risks

Alcohol can lead to dry mouth and irritation of oral tissues.

Benefits

It acts as a preservative and can help dissolve other ingredients.

BIO30 New Zealand Propolis
Good

Propolis is a natural resinous mixture produced by bees and has antimicrobial properties. It can help reduce oral bacteria and support gum health. It is a natural ingredient that has been used traditionally for its health benefits.

Risks

Allergic reactions may occur in individuals sensitive to bee products.

Benefits

Propolis can help reduce oral bacteria and support gum health.

Mentha piperita (Peppermint) oil
Good

Peppermint oil is known for its antimicrobial properties and ability to freshen breath. It provides a pleasant flavor and can help reduce oral bacteria. It is a natural ingredient commonly used in oral care products.

Risks

In rare cases, it may cause irritation or allergic reactions.

Benefits

Peppermint oil helps freshen breath and reduce oral bacteria.
